    Grandma Bogey's Grandama's Fudge


    Source of Recipe


    Buddy Cookbook

    List of Ingredients




    3 cups of sugar
    1 envelope of unflavored gelatin
    1 cup of milk
    1/2 cup of light corn syrup
    3 squares (1 oz. size) of unsweetened chocolate
    1 1/4 cup of butter or margarine
    2 teaspoons of vanilla extract
    1 cup of coarsely chopped walnuts

    Butter 8 x 8 x 2 inch pan. In 3 1/2 quart saucepan, mix sugar with dry gelatin. Add milk, corn syrup, unsweetened chocolate, and butter. Cook over medium heat and, stirring frequently, to 238ºF. on candy thermometer, or until a little in cold water forms soft ball that flattens when removed from water. Remove from heat. Pour into large mixing bowl. Stir in vanilla. Cool 25 minutes. Beat with wooden spoon until candy thickens. Stir in walnuts. Spread in prepared pan. Let cool, then cut into squares. Makes about 2 1/2 pounds.
